Steven Noah Farber entered into rest on Monday, April 10, 2023 at the age of 76 after a long struggle with Parkinson's Disease, in his apartment at Orchard Cove Senior Living, in Canton, MA and was laid to rest in Sharon Memorial Park on Tuesday, April 11 in a small, private Jewish ceremony.
Steven was born to Hy and Florence Farber in New York City on June 6, 1946, and was raised by them with strong support from his beloved uncles David and Elmer Ferber. He married his high school sweetheart Susan, with whom he had three beloved children; went to Brooklyn College, joined the Coast Guard during the draft, attended Harvard Law School, where he was an Editor of the Harvard Law review, and - after a brief stint in Atlanta - rose through the ranks of the world of corporate law to become a specialist in tax and contract law and managing partner at Boston firms Hale and Dorr and Palmer and Dodge before taking early retirement due to the onset of Parkinson's.
Steven was especially proud to be connected with so many, in so many different ways. He maintained friendships from his childhood, his high school and college years, and law school, and through the many charities, missions, social service organizations, schools, and law firms to which he devoted his time. He was a founding member of other, smaller communities, including his beloved men's group and book group, and had deep roots in the Cajun dance, jazz, blues, and folk and roots music and festival communities as well. He traveled well and broadly across the globe and to every one of the US states, and honored many by sharing those travel experiences with them. And no matter how busy he was, he always made time for family and friends, with what to some seemed like an endless reservoir of time, capacity, and love.
He is survived by his son Joshua, his wife Darcie, and his grandchildren Willow and Cassia; his son Jesse and his wife Jasmine, his son Max, and hundreds of beloved friends and family.
